Output e1dcf9686a68363c25cdf4cd7e7b1e3ad234cadef0af7b1b1ab7d8e813614a69:25

value
425998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ba03d64920491c96c8e1d66141769619eed0fab OP_EQUAL
address
35fgwT4ECqLf5S6a8RD7kVfgkfC9e52Q82
transaction
e1dcf9686a68363c25cdf4cd7e7b1e3ad234cadef0af7b1b1ab7d8e813614a69
spent
true